Historical Background
Decatur County was established in 1845 and named after Commodore Stephen Decatur, a notable figure in the early 19th century U.S. Navy. Purpose of General Sessions Court
The General Sessions Court in South Carolina primarily deals with felony cases, which are more serious offenses that can lead to substantial penalties, including imprisonment. This court also addresses certain misdemeanor cases and appeals from lower courts. Understanding the court’s role is vital for anyone navigating the judicial system.
Structure of General Sessions Court
- Judges: General Sessions Courts are presided over by Circuit Judges. These judges are appointed to ensure fair trials and adherence to legal standards.
- Jurisdiction: The court has jurisdiction over felony criminal cases, which can include violent crimes, drug offenses, and property crimes.
- Court Sessions: The court typically holds sessions throughout the year, where various cases are scheduled for hearings and trials.
The Process of a General Sessions Court Case
The proceedings in General Sessions Court generally follow a structured process:
- Arrest and Initial Appearance: Following an arrest, the defendant will have an initial appearance where charges are read, and bail may be set.
- Preliminary Hearing: A preliminary hearing may occur to determine if there is enough evidence to proceed with the case. This stage helps safeguard defendants from unfounded charges.
- Indictment: If the evidence is sufficient, the case moves forward with an indictment issued by a grand jury.
- Trial: During the trial, both prosecution and defense present their cases. The prosecution must prove the defendant’s guilt beyond a reasonable doubt.
- Verdict and Sentencing: After deliberation, the jury or judge delivers a verdict. If found guilty, sentencing will follow based on statutory guidelines.
Rights of Defendants
Defendants in General Sessions Court have specific rights designed to ensure fair treatment throughout the proceedings:
- The Right to Counsel: Defendants are entitled to legal representation. If they cannot afford an attorney, one will be provided.
- The Right to a Speedy Trial: The Sixth Amendment guarantees the right to a trial without unnecessary delay.
- The Right to Due Process: Defendants have the right to fair procedures and hearings before being deprived of life, liberty, or property.
